Nancy "Nannie" Mahalya Williard

Female 1883 - 1951  (67 years)

  1. 1.  Nancy "Nannie" Mahalya Williard was born on 22 May 1883 in Georgia; died on 26 Apr 1951; was buried in Liberty Hill Cemetery, Bland Lake, San Augustine County, Texas.

    Notes:

    Date of birth and death shown as they were engraved on her headstone.

    Family/Spouse: Columbus Lee Whitton. Columbus (son of William Washington Whitton and Mary Lydia Hughes) was born on 13 Aug 1865 in Texas; died on 29 Jan 1961; was buried in Liberty Hill Cemetery, Bland Lake, San Augustine County, Texas. [Group Sheet] [Family Chart]

  1. 2.  Harlowe Whitton Descendancy chart to this point (1.Nancy1) was born on 15 Aug 1912 in Texas; died on 17 Jun 2007 in Texas; was buried in Liberty Hill Cemetery, Bland Lake, San Augustine County, Texas.

    Notes:

    SAN AUGUSTINE - Funeral services for Harlowe Whitton Johnson, 94, of San Augustine will 11 a.m. Wednesday, June 20, 2007, at Wyman Roberts Memorial Chapel with the Rev. Jim White officiating. Burial will be in Liberty Hill Cemetery in San Augustine under the direction of Wyman Roberts Funeral Home. Mrs. Johnson died Sunday, June 17, 2007, at her residence. She was born Aug. 25, 1912, in San Augustine to Columbus Lee Whitton and Nannie Willard Whitton. Mrs. Johnson was an educator. She was a member of First United Methodist Church, Delta Kappa Gamma, and the Daughters of the Republic of Texas. Survivors include her daughters, Evva Dene Dymke of San Augustine and Johnida Evans of Garden Ridge; sons, William "Bud" Johnson of San Augustine; sisters, Allene Hankla of Houston and Rosa Ambrose of San Augustine; one brother-in-law; one sister-in-law; 13 grandchildren; and 15 great-grandchildren.   3. 4.  Allene Whitton Descendancy chart to this point (1.Nancy1) was born on 10 Nov 1919 in San Augustine County, Texas; died on 8 May 2012 in Houston, Harris County, Texas; was buried in Liberty Hill Cemetery, Bland Lake, San Augustine County, Texas.

    Notes:

    The Sabine County Reporter
    May 16, 2012, Page 14

    Allene Whitton Hankla

    Mrs. Allene (Whitton) Hankla, 92, originally from San Augustine, and had prior lived in California, passed from this life on Tuesday, May 8, 2012, in Houston.

    Mrs. Hankla was born to Nannie (Williard) Whitton and Columbus Lee Whitton on Nov. 10, 1919, in San Augustine County, TX. She and her late husband, Randolph Hankla, Sr., made their home in California for many years before retiring and coming back to her native state of Texas. She was employed as a college administrator, where she also was an educator, where she taught as a teacher, counselor, and served as a Night Dean for Santa Rosa Jr. College, and she was a member of the Eastern Star, Kappa Kappa Gamma, Daughters of the Republic (DAR), Daughters of the Nile, California Teachers Association, and the NEA, and a member of the Methodist Church.

    Funeral services were held Saturday, May 12, in the Wyman Roberts Memorial Chapel, with Rev. Jean Ferraro officiating. Interment followed in the Liberty Hill Cemetery.

    Those who are survived by her include: son, Randal (Randy) Hankla of Houston; grandson, Marcus Ramirez of Houston; Granddaughter, Ryanne Allen Hankla of San Antonio; sister, Rosa Lee Ambrose of San Augustine; along with numerous nieces and nephews and cousins.

    She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band, Randolph Hankla, Sr.; and sisters, Mildred Smith and Harlowe Johnson.

  4. 5.  Rosa Lee Whitton Descendancy chart to this point (1.Nancy1) was born on 9 May 1927 in San Augustine County, Texas; died on 10 Sep 2015 in San Augustine, San Augustine County, Texas; was buried in Liberty Hill Cemetery, Bland Lake, San Augustine County, Texas.

    Notes:

    Rosa Lee Ambrose born May 9, 1927 to Columbus Lee Whitton and Nancy Mahalya (Willard) Whitton. Ms. Rosa has passed in peace and comfort in her home town of San Augustine. In the care of Twin Lakes Nursing Center, assisted by Affinity Hospice, with a dedicated staff and a force of volunteers Ms. Rosa called Twin Lakes home for 8 years.

    A student at University Of Texas in the early 40's she moved to San Francisco with her sister Allene and brother-in-law Randolph Hankla. Working at Treasure Island as a teletype operator Rosa met her second husband, Kenneth S. Kutch. In her lifetime Rosa loved to cook, was a seamstress, rounded up Cub Scouts, Boy Scouts, and Girl Scouts, as well as a few DAR Members. In addition to DAR, she involved herself in The Historical Society, The San Augustine Study Club, The Timber Growers Association, and was active as a Voting Judge into 2008. Living in Texas, Illinois, Wisconsin, California, Michigan, and passing through another dozen plus states an interest in her country was always present. A secret pleasure was her participation in the Veteran's Day Celebration with the DAR.

    Rosa enjoyed being a mother and raised her three and two dozen more. Scouting was one of those joys she could share and really shine. Camping, fishing , boating she was always game and usually drove. Rosa met Ralph and married adding another four children to her influence.

    Upon retiring Ralph and Rosa chose to move home to San Augustine and enjoy those things that meant the most. Joining into the community Rosa was a member of the First United Methodist Church singing in the choir and engaging in fellowship with friends , family, and congregation.
